導航:首頁 > 數據行情 > TuShare提供的股票數據

TuShare提供的股票數據

發布時間:2022-05-12 15:10:51

① 請問有類似tushare的財經股票數據API嗎

題主是做量化回測嗎?我覺得用大智慧、同花順的公式平台就可以了。這些都是上市公司,數據齊備,公式平台開發也很簡單,基本上不需要有編程經驗,看看軟體中的指標、公式等例子就會使用了。而且每個指標都有詳細的中文說明。

如果是企業機構等,有專門的金融實時行情API介面,例如微盛的金融實時行情API介面。我之前在券商實習時,師兄所在部門就使用微盛的金融API介面進行測試。他們的優點是支持市場多,幾乎涵蓋了內地、海外的所有主要市場,包括現貨、期貨、期權。例如師兄當時做上證50的套利測試,微盛的API介麵包括了上證50成分股現貨、中金所的上證50股指期貨、以及上證50期權(很多介面都沒有期權,這樣不方便做套利測試)。不過他們介面的缺點是需要有編程基礎,沒有編程基礎是搞不定的(需要有專門的程序員來開發),這個不適合普通投資者使用。

② 如何獲取實時的股票數據

要跟供應商協商得到他的介面才能得到實時股票行情數據;
股票實時行情,可以通過兩個方法來進行查看:
第一種,在網路搜索頁面直接輸入股票代碼,如:000717,網路輸入後,即可在搜索結果中看到,其中分時,就是該股票在當天的實時走向。

第二種,通過炒股軟體,如東財,同花順等,在開啟後,直接輸入,股票代碼,如600854,點擊回車。進入的第一個頁面就是該股票在當天的實時行情。

同時在股票軟體的分時成交界面,可以查看到每一分鍾的成交價和手數。股票行情趨勢判斷必要時也需要結合分時成交界面的數據來進行判斷。

查看其它股票的行情也是一樣的道理,直接鍵入該股票的代碼就可以查看到該股票當天或某個時間段內的行情。當然,精準的行情走勢、趨勢,是需要結合多種指標來共同進行分析的。

③ 如何從tushare中調取十大股東數據

0. 簡介

TuShare是一個免費、開源的Python財經數據介麵包。主要實現對股票等金融數據從數據採集、清洗加工 到 數據存儲的過程,能夠為金融分析人員提供快速、整潔、和多樣的便於分析的數據,為他們在數據獲取方面極大地減輕工作量,使他們更加專注於策略和模型的研究與實現上。考慮到Python pandas包在金融量化分析中體現出的優勢,TuShare返回的絕大部分的數據格式都是pandas DataFrame類型。
1. 歷史行情
獲取個股歷史交易數據(包括均線數據),可以通過參數設置獲取日k線、周k線、月k線,以及5分鍾、15分鍾、30分鍾和60分鍾k線數據。本介面只能獲取近3年的日線數據,適合搭配均線數據進行選股和分析。

參數說明:
code:股票代碼,即6位數字代碼,或者指數代碼(sh=上證指數 sz=深圳成指 hs300=滬深300指數 sz50=上證50 zxb=中小板 cyb=創業板)
start:開始日期,格式YYYY-MM-DD
end:結束日期,格式YYYY-MM-DD
ktype:數據類型,D=日k線 W=周 M=月 5=5分鍾 15=15分鍾 30=30分鍾 60=60分鍾,默認為D
retry_count:當網路異常後重試次數,默認為3
pause:重試時停頓秒數,默認為0
返回值說明:
date:日期
open:開盤價
high:最高價
close:收盤價
low:最低價
volume:成交量
price_change:價格變動
p_change:漲跌幅
ma5:5日均價
ma10:10日均價
ma20:20日均價
v_ma5:5日均量
v_ma10:10日均量
v_ma20:20日均量
turnover:換手率[註:指數無此項]
(1) #獲取全部日k線數據(查看前11行)

④ 國內量化交易軟體排行榜

隨著TPS交易系統體系概念的興起,很多人會好奇量化交易系統,到底有什麼「魔力」。今天就一起來看看,TPS量化交易系統,有哪些新亮點、新玩法。
新亮點
勝率高達92.58%
勝率這個問題,基本是新手第一關心內容,有經驗的投資者關心的更多風控和盈虧比。目前,TPS量化交易系統的勝率在92.58%左右。勝率這里我們希望大家別太過於看中,因為交易非定量,不像拋硬幣不是正面就是反面,交易存在漲、跌、盤整、還有額外的交易點差手續費。不是高勝率就是好信號,理論上誰都能做出高勝率,甚至100%勝率。只需要下單時盈利一小點的單子平倉,錯誤的單子嚴格止盈止損。
盈利率較高
相對於傳統人工做法,TPS量化交易系統擁有較高盈利率優勢:
1.每個月預期40.28%的盈利率
2.按照10萬美金5%的倉位,每月預計盈利5萬美金左右。
交易系統穩定
無論是平台還是交易軟體,投資者最看重的就是穩定性,一個穩定的交易系統對於投資者來說是很有優勢的,很多投資者在剛開始都沒有意識到穩定性對他們的重要性,直到在交易中使用了一個不穩定的交易系統,才發現交易過程狀況百出,最後,交易結果也和他們的交易表現不成正比。而TPS量化交易系統擁有數據更新及時、可靠的交易數據等優勢,不會出現扛單,甚至是大虧大賺的情況,這對於投資者在參與交易時,是非常有利的。

⑤ 怎樣使用tushare的提供的數據與庫talib計算macd

安裝TuShare
方式1:pip install tushare
方式2:訪問https://pypi.python.org/pypi/tushare/下載安裝
方式3:將源代碼下載到本地python setup.py install
升級TuShare
1、先查看本地與線上的版本版本號:
pip search tushare
2、升級TuShare:
pip install tushare --upgrade
確認安裝成功
import tushare as ts
print ts.__version__
獲取歷史交易數據
import tushare as ts
df = ts.get_hist_data('600848')
ts.get_hist_data('600848',ktype='W') #獲取周k線數據
ts.get_hist_data('600848',ktype='M') #獲取月k線數據
ts.get_hist_data('600848',ktype='5') #獲取5分鍾k線數據
ts.get_hist_data('600848',ktype='15') #獲取15分鍾k線數據
ts.get_hist_data('600848',ktype='30') #獲取30分鍾k線數據
ts.get_hist_data('600848',ktype='60') #獲取60分鍾k線數據
ts.get_hist_data('sh')#獲取上證指數k線數據,其它參數與個股一致,下同
ts.get_hist_data('sz')#獲取深圳成指k線數據 ts.get_hist_data('hs300')#獲取滬深300指數k線數據
ts.get_hist_data('sz50')#獲取上證50指數k線數據
ts.get_hist_data('zxb')#獲取中小板指數k線數據
ts.get_hist_data('cyb')#獲取創業板指數k線數據
Python財經數據介麵包TuShare的使用
獲取歷史分筆數據
df = ts.get_tick_data('000756','2015-03-27')
df.head(10)
Python財經數據介麵包TuShare的使用
獲取實時分筆數據
df = ts.get_realtime_quotes('000581')
print df[['code','name','price','bid','ask','volume','amount','time']]
返回值說明:
0:name,股票名字
1:open,今日開盤價
2:pre_close,昨日收盤價
3:price,當前價格
4:high,今日最高價
5:low,今日最低價
6:bid,競買價,即「買一」報價
7:ask,競賣價,即「賣一」報價
8:volumn,成交量 maybe you need do volumn/100
9:amount,成交金額(元 CNY)
10:b1_v,委買一(筆數 bid volume)
11:b1_p,委買一(價格 bid price)
12:b2_v,「買二」
13:b2_p,「買二」
14:b3_v,「買三」
15:b3_p,「買三」
16:b4_v,「買四」
17:b4_p,「買四」
18:b5_v,「買五」
19:b5_p,「買五」
20:a1_v,委賣一(筆數 ask volume)
21:a1_p,委賣一(價格 ask price)
...
30:date,日期
31:time,時間

⑥ python tushare炒股好用嗎

[python] view plain
#!/usr/bin/python
# coding: UTF-8

"""This script parse stock info"""

import tushare as ts

def get_all_price(code_list):
'''''process all stock'''
df = ts.get_realtime_quotes(STOCK)
print df

if __name__ == '__main__':
STOCK = ['600219', ##南山鋁業
'000002', ##萬 科A
'000623', ##吉林敖東
'000725', ##京東方A
'600036', ##招商銀行
'601166', ##興業銀行
'600298', ##安琪酵母
'600881', ##亞泰集團
'002582', ##好想你
'600750', ##江中葯業
'601088', ##中國神華
'000338', ##濰柴動力
'000895', ##雙匯發展
'000792'] ##鹽湖股份

get_all_price(STOCK)

上述的代碼就是調用 ts 的 get_realtime_quotes 這個介面,獲取並列印對應的股票數據。

保存成tushare-example.py這個文件後,執行結果如下:

[python] view plain
# python tushare-example.py
name open pre_close price high low bid ask \
0 南山鋁業 6.090 6.040 6.020 6.240 6.000 6.010 6.030
1 萬 科A 0.00 24.43 0.00 0.00 0 0.00 0.00
2 吉林敖東 23.80 23.89 23.42 23.81 23.39 23.41 23.42
3 京東方A 2.30 2.31 2.30 2.31 2.29 2.29 2.30
4 招商銀行 14.900 14.880 14.860 14.930 14.780 14.870 14.880
5 興業銀行 14.380 14.380 14.420 14.500 14.350 14.420 14.430
6 安琪酵母 32.570 32.610 32.270 33.500 32.010 32.260 32.290
7 亞泰集團 5.020 5.040 4.920 5.030 4.910 4.910 4.920
8 好想你 0.00 15.62 0.00 0.00 0 0.00 0.00
9 江中葯業 25.910 26.050 25.510 26.100 25.500 25.500 25.510
10 中國神華 13.150 13.130 13.100 13.220 13.090 13.090 13.100
11 濰柴動力 7.26 7.24 7.18 7.28 7.16 7.17 7.18
12 雙匯發展 18.15 18.17 18.20 18.25 18.10 18.20 18.21
13 鹽湖股份 18.21 18.37 17.84 18.36 17.80 17.83 17.84

volume amount ... a2_p a3_v a3_p a4_v a4_p \
0 57575165 351584271.000 ... 6.040 649 6.050 764 6.060
1 0 0.00 ... 0.00 0.00 0.00
2 11613023 274208845.93 ... 23.43 260 23.44 3 23.45
3 200290823 460365710.26 ... 2.31 121698 2.32 65422 2.33
4 16885368 250744421.000 ... 14.890 2746 14.900 1060 14.910
5 44311362 639044453.000 ... 14.440 2299 14.450 1971 14.460
6 6430819 211088364.000 ... 32.300 50 32.390 3 32.400
7 11602430 57638953.000 ... 4.930 1358 4.940 1207 4.950
8 0 0.00 ... 0.00 0.00 0.00
9 8142359 209824301.000 ... 25.520 37 25.530 48 25.540
10 11113228 146177929.000 ... 13.110 176 13.120 92 13.130
11 13815858 99641720.65 ... 7.19 1783 7.20 540 7.21
12 3251027 59110247.93 ... 18.22 235 18.23 248 18.24
13 14408288 259983524.09 ... 17.85 118 17.86 22 17.87

a5_v a5_p date time code
0 575 6.070 2016-02-05 15:00:00 600219
1 0.00 2016-02-05 15:05:56 000002
2 19 23.46 2016-02-05 15:05:56 000623
3 55669 2.34 2016-02-05 15:05:56 000725
4 790 14.920 2016-02-05 15:00:00 600036
5 3526 14.470 2016-02-05 15:00:00 601166
6 8 32.470 2016-02-05 15:00:00 600298
7 893 4.960 2016-02-05 15:00:00 600881
8 0.00 2016-02-05 15:05:56 002582
9 78 25.550 2016-02-05 15:00:00 600750
10 206 13.140 2016-02-05 15:00:00 601088
11 668 7.22 2016-02-05 15:05:56 000338
12 506 18.25 2016-02-05 15:05:56 000895
13 28 17.88 2016-02-05 15:05:56 000792

bingo!

⑦ 如何從tushare獲得某一日的所有漲停股票

你可以在你交易軟體上查看就可以的啊

⑧ 100銀子求助如何遍歷讀取TuShare的分筆股票數據

import tushare as ts
import time

while True:
df = ts.get_realtime_quotes('000581') #Single stock symbol
print df[['code','name','price','bid','ask','volume','amount','time']]
time.sleep(2)

根據 http://tushare.org/trading.html#id6 提供的例子,你可以包裝成函數,傳入你要獲取的股票代碼,df包含30個列的內容,你可以輸出你想要的列,也可以保存到資料庫里。
tushare.org上都寫得很清楚了。
遍歷讀取無非就是
import tushare as ts

df = ts.get_tick_data('600848',date='2014-01-09')

for i in df.index:

print df.loc[i]
print df.loc[i]['price']
其中i就是序號,以i為基礎你可以獲取所有row的數據,包括具體某一行某一列。python根據坐標讀取數據有多重方法,你學明白python後,tushare用起來就方便了。

⑨ 個人做量化交易需要注意些什麼

一說到量化投資,一下子蹦出來一堆厲害的語匯,例如:FPGA,微波加熱,高頻率,納秒等級延遲時間這些。這種全是高頻交易中的語匯,高頻交易的確是基金管理公司做起來較為適合,平常人搞起來門檻較為高。

模擬交易最後實際效果一般在於你的程序流程是不是靈便,是不是優良的風險性和資金分配優化演算法。

總結:對於說本人做量化投資是不是可靠,上邊的步驟早已表明了實際可策劃方案,可靠性顯而易見。對於能否賺到錢,就看本人的修為了更好地。

⑩ 有什麼免費的股票數據web api

免費的很多,例如新浪的web api。但這種會被對方封IP。
其實免費的,最好是使用股票軟體中自帶的介面。例如通達信、同花順、大智慧的公式系統。這些軟體裡面可編寫公式,通過這些公式,就可按自己要求得到對應的股票數據了。
如果是機構,有專業的這種API介面的提供。例如微盛的金融實時行情API介面,但這種需要軟體人員才搞得懂,一般人沒法使用。

閱讀全文

與TuShare提供的股票數據相關的資料

熱點內容
中國生物股票一覽表 瀏覽:674
證券股票報告分析 瀏覽:330
香港怎麼開股票戶 瀏覽:509
平安證券怎麼看股票開戶多久了 瀏覽:848
甲企業通過證券公司購入上市公司股票 瀏覽:662
st敦種股票為什麼下跌 瀏覽:41
股票期權走勢軟體 瀏覽:748
天邦股份股票最低價格 瀏覽:976
數碼科技股票是哪家公司 瀏覽:425
如何學習炒股票投資 瀏覽:279
中國股票結算電話 瀏覽:919
股票資金正數和負數 瀏覽:374
股票模擬賬戶用哪個好 瀏覽:883
股票南北資金流向 瀏覽:768
股票主力控盤程度 瀏覽:783
哪家銀行的股票值得投資 瀏覽:768
股票條件單神器 瀏覽:612
同一家銀行的綁定股票賬戶 瀏覽:128
股票投資的收益來自哪裡 瀏覽:798
房地產股票長期持有的結果 瀏覽:550